Hy,i am a begginer player.I started playing some months ago,and at the moment i play at 5NL on PS.
I begin the session well,i manage to go up 2-3 buyins,but after a time i lose the buyins and i lose another 10-15 $.
I wanted to ask for some advice,any will be well received.
Has it happened to you and if it did what did you do or what do you do?
Thanks in advance !!

Know your limits. No one can play A game forever. Only when your B and C game are profitable too you can play long sessions. So until then keep breaks, small ones and big ones, sports and walking and eating away from the pc. My A game lasts about 20 minutes in zoom, then B came continues till about 2 hours, after that I go directly to F game.

There is no strict time limit though, it's a feeling that I make out of ordinary moves, sometimes it takes longer to notice. So if you are tired A game lasts shorter and so on.

try to leave the table and join another one after you double or triple your stack because 100bb are enough to play comfortably and if you are playing with 300bb you might lose a hand to another player with a similar stack and lose 300 bb in one single hand, so unless no one at the table has a big stack, my advise is to leave the table and join another one unless there are lots of weak players on the table. also try to play with good hands and take advantage when you are in a good position ( cutoff, button)

Have you been a successful player on those limits for some period like two weeks or a month? You must set a goal for you and try to follow it up.
Set a time frame that you will sit on the table. Maybe after an hour you are starting to lose focus. This is something very common. On how many tables are you playing? This is also important. Maybe you must try to reduce the number of tables.
